WebNov 2, 2024 · Question One should be a quick annotation on the clock and data diagrams sketched earlier: I generally use the 10-90 rule for measuring rise/fall: 10% of starting … WebAug 10, 2012 · Now, to avoid the hold violation at the launching flop, the data should remain stable for some time (T hold) after the clock edge. The equation to be satisfied to avoid hold violation looks somewhat like below: T c2q + T comb ≥ T hold + T skew (2)
